I was a little late this morning and saw the nice clouds in the sky so rushed over to Owens Pond as the closest place I could think of to be on time. And at that I was a few minutes late. Getting to this spot was good cardio.I really liked the ground fog hanging over the water.
I did find one bloodroot flower to photograph and that will show up later. It is still a bit early, but I’ll go again tomorrow when I think more of the bloodroot will be open and maybe some of the purple trillium buds will pop later today. We’re getting there.
